2 killed in southwest Edmonton shooting, including prominent home builder

By News Staff

Edmonton police say two men were killed and another was seriously injured in a daylight shooting in the city’s southwest Monday.

Officers were called to Cavanagh Boulevard SW and Cherniak Way SW – outside a construction site in a residential area – for the report of a shooting around noon.

Police say a 49-year-old man and 57-year-old man were found dead. Autopsies were scheduled for Tuesday and Wednesday.

A 51-year-old man was seriously injured and taken to hospital with life-threatening injuries. Edmonton police say they are not looking for any suspects.

Witnesses and community members confirm one of those killed was a prominent Edmonton home builder. Buta Singh Gill, the owner of Gill Built Homes, is being remembered for his generosity and an active member of his local gurudwara.

A large crowd was gathered at the scene Monday afternoon as homicide detectives investigated.
